Recently a VA on a VA forum asked the questions about e-book cover software – something that would make creating a good looking e-book cover for promoting the e-book.
I’ve always created my own in Illustrator but was keen to hear what easier options there were.
These came recommended by other VAs.
Quick 3D Cover Maker – http://www.nervepreserve.com/ – is very quick, simple and productive graphical tool for developers, authors and designers who need good quality 3D cover illustrations. The program makes 3D pictures of boxshots, CD, DVD, Blue-ray boxes, eBooks covers more. The program allows to create professional level web illustrations literally with a few mouse clicks.
E-book Generator – http://www.armandmorin.com/ebook/ – Our New eBook Software gives you all the features you could ever want in an ebook software now or in the future. Here’s the real deal…
My e-cover maker – http://www.myecovermaker.com/ – MyEcoverMaker is an extremely easy to use point-and-click online software to create ebook covers without the need for expensive software like photoshop and plugins to create stunning 3D eCovers
